In like manner of making assessments and at the same time and subject to the same rights of protest and appeal, the commissioners shall also assess and place opposite each tract of land on the assessment roll an estimate of all damages that will accrue to any landowner by reason of works or proposed works of improvement, including injury to lands taken or damaged; and when said commissioners return no assessment of damages as to any tract of land, it shall be deemed a finding by them that no damages will be sustained.
